What Are Dual Control Vehicles?
dual control Vehicles (dev01.open-alt.com) are specifically modified cars and trucks geared up with extra controls that mirror those of the trainer's side. Normally, a dual control vehicle includes 2 sets of pedals: the driver's side with the basic controls (accelerator, brake, and clutch in manual vehicles) and the traveler trainer's side with an extra set of controls. This style enables instructors to intervene and take control of the vehicle whenever required, consequently boosting safety throughout the learner's driving lessons.

Improved Safety
The main advantage of dual control vehicles depends on their ability to significantly improve safety throughout lessons. Instructors can take control of the automobile if the learner makes an error or loses control, lowering the risk of accidents.
2. Increased Confidence for Learners
Learners often experience anxiety while driving, particularly with complicated traffic scenarios. Understanding that their trainer can step in can relieve a few of this pressure, allowing students to focus better on mastering their driving skills.

4. Real-time Feedback and Guidance
Instructors can use immediate feedback to learners throughout driving sessions, enhancing the educational worth. They can demonstrate the appropriate action by taking control of the lorry, which serves as a practical example for learners.
